Output 28b9910656181b9b3b6c095b339857d2442267a74bcc7837684c78a96124565b:0

value
850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beb0ad74a583430e99960fe1f83e97aa29ee3ecf OP_EQUAL
address
3K5HxmFJjAFoM49nawYb8JHhKB2M8RMr78
transaction
28b9910656181b9b3b6c095b339857d2442267a74bcc7837684c78a96124565b
spent
true